Virtuous Villains

An old writing instructor of mine claimed that the most believable villains are the ones who really believe that what they do is good.

Write a story about a villain whose actions are viewed are evil in the eyes of the narrator, but who views himself as the good guy, whether he is misguided, acting on imperfect information, using a different ethical calculus, is just on the “wrong” side of a dispute that is not black-and-white, or for any other clever reason you can think of.
